Regular Veterinary Check-Ups

Routine visits to your veterinarian at New Market Animal Hospital are vital for your pet’s health. These check-ups allow for early detection of health problems, vaccinations, and dental care. Aim for an annual exam for young adults and more frequent visits for seniors or pets with specific health concerns. Your vet can also provide invaluable advice on nutrition and weight management tailored to your pet’s needs.

Maintain a Balanced Diet

Nutrition plays a significant role in your pet’s overall health. Feeding your pets a balanced diet helps prevent obesity, which can lead to various health issues, including diabetes and joint problems. Consult with your veterinarian about the best food options for your pet’s age, size, and activity level. Regularly monitor their weight and adjust portion sizes as necessary to maintain a healthy weight.

Exercise and Mental Stimulation

Physical activity is essential for maintaining a pet’s physical and mental health. Dogs need regular walks and playtime, while cats benefit from interactive toys and climbing structures. Engaging in daily exercise not only helps manage weight but also reduces behavioral problems stemming from boredom. Mental stimulation is equally important — consider puzzle toys or obedience training sessions to keep their minds sharp.

Preventative Medications

Protect your pets from parasites such as fleas, ticks, and heartworms by keeping them on a regular preventative medication schedule. Speak with your veterinarian about the best options for your pet, as some medications offer broader protection than others. Seasonal changes can affect the prevalence of certain parasites, so adjust your medication routine accordingly.

Dental Care

Oral health is often overlooked by pet owners, yet it plays a critical role in overall wellness. Establish a routine dental care regimen that includes regular teeth brushing and dental chews. Schedule professional dental cleanings as recommended by your veterinarian, especially if your pet shows signs of periodontal disease, such as bad breath or gum inflammation.
